Publisher Description

Winner of the thirty-fourth annual 3-Day Novel Contest, the infamous literary marathon held every Labor Day weekend.

Music journalist Evan Strocker has almost finished a book about his time with Heidegger Stairwell, a legendary indie-rock band. But the band thinks he's left a little too much of himself on the page—letting his experiences as a transgender man and his complicated "romance" with the lead guitarist eclipse the story of the group's dramatic rise and fall. Through notes and marginalia, the musicians argue over their friend's version of the truth and fight to put their own testimony on record.

Kayt Burgess has an MA in creative writing from Bath Spa University (UK). This is her first novel.
